Every human that has ever died is either resurrected or remains a ghost to this day. They are all around us, billions of them. With them are also an unknown number of spirits who are yet to have been born and even more who are on this earth but will never be born. We are ghosts in a body. There is nothing scary or evil about it.

That said, necromancy is against the commandments of the LORD. Most of it is foolishness and phony anyway.
